Mastering Readability and Design Balance

While Saltery is incredibly attractive, using it effectively requires an understanding of scale and spacing. Because it mimics a natural brush stroke, some letters may have tighter connections than others. When using this font for small stickers or tiny product tags, always test print at actual size first. Ensure that the loops do not close up too much, which can happen if the font size is too small. For best results, keep Saltery at a size where the details remain crisp and legible.

Font pairing is another critical skill for any designer. Since Saltery is expressive and fluid, it needs a stable partner. Try pairing it with a clean sans serif font for a modern, minimalist look. This combination works perfectly for logo design and social media graphics, where clarity is key. Alternatively, if you want a more traditional or romantic feel, pair it with a subtle serif font. This contrast helps guide the viewer’s eye, allowing the script to shine as the focal point while the secondary font provides necessary information.

Before diving into your next project, check the specific file formats included with your download. Most premium fonts come in OTF and TTF formats, which are compatible with most design software like Adobe Illustrator, Photoshop, and Canva. If you are creating SVG-style designs for cutting machines, you may need to convert the text or use software that supports font-to-SVG conversion. Always verify if the font includes alternates, ligatures, or swashes. These extra glyphs allow you to customize the look, preventing repetitive patterns when the same letter appears multiple times in a word.

Licensing and Commercial Use

As a commercial craft seller, understanding licensing is non-negotiable. Most fonts purchased from reputable sources like Script Amp come with a commercial license that allows you to use them in physical products you sell, such as printed invitations, mugs, and shirts. However, always read the specific license agreement included with Saltery. Some licenses may restrict embedding the font file itself in digital templates or web design projects. Ensuring you are compliant protects your business and respects the work of the type designer.
